Ex-Witcher 3, Hitman, Dying Light Devs Form New Studio
Ex-developers of AAA games like The Witcher 3: Wild Hunt, Hitman, and Dying Light have teamed up to form a new development studio in Wroclaw, Poland. TowerFall Ascension Announced and Dated for Xbox One
TowerFall Ascension developer Matt Thorson has announced that the four-player local competitive platformer will be available on Xbox One from Jan 25, 2017, reports Eurogamer. New Overwatch Event Begins Next Week, Watch the Teaser Now
The next Overwatch in-game event has been announced. Blizzard announced today that a Year of the Rooster event will begin on January 24. Super Mario Run Comes to Android in March
Nintendo’s Mario auto-runner, Super Mario Run, will launch on Android in March. Nintendo announced the launch month today in a tweet. A specific date was not mentioned, but people on Android can pre-register to find out exactly when it launches.
